Abstract
The invention provides a side-wall water-cooled surface grate segment and an incinerator. A cooling water cavity is formed in the furnace grate segment. According to the side-wall water-cooled furnace grate segment provided by the invention, it can be guaranteed that the surface temperature of the furnace grate segment is below 200 DEG C, and thermal stress of a furnace grate during operation is decreased so that damage, caused by high temperature, to the furnace grate segment can be avoided, and the service life of the furnace grate segment is prolonged; and material wastage is reduced, and the operating cost is reduced.

The present invention provides a kind of side wall water bar, as shown in Figure 1 and Figure 2, including header board 1, back plate 2, internal water cavity 3,
Bolt sleeve 4, water inlet 5, outlet 6 and water cavity dividing plate 7.
Water bar of the present invention is provided with cooling water cavity, for carrying out cold to described side wall water bar
But.
Exemplarily, described cooling water cavity is welded by header board 1, back plate 2.With the production of existing employing casting technique
Side wall fire grate segment is compared, and the side wall water bar that the present invention provides uses and is welded, and described fire grate segment can use conventional
Metal material manufacture, such as cast iron etc., without using special material, thus cost is greatly reduced.
Exemplarily, it is provided with water cavity dividing plate 7 inside described cooling water cavity.Described water cavity dividing plate 7 is handed over inside cooling water cavity
Wrong welding, to constitute snakelike cooling water channel.Described water cavity dividing plate 7 make cooling water at cooling water cavity inherent laws along snakelike
Water route circuitous flow, extends flowing time, and can be prevented effectively from the large-area flow dead of appearance and high-temperature region, local, very
The service life of fire grate segment is extended in big degree.Described water cavity dividing plate 7 also acts as what welding between header board 1 and back plate 2 was strengthened
Effect.The sparse degree of water cavity dividing plate 7 can be carried out by those skilled in the art according to practical situations such as the fuel values of combustible
Adjust.
Exemplarily, described side wall water bar includes the water inlet 5 being disposed below and the water outlet being positioned above
Mouth 6.Described water inlet 5 and outlet 6 are positioned at back plate 2 side, are connected with water-cooling system.Described water inlet 5 and outlet 6 are respectively
It is positioned at the two ends of snakelike cooling water channel.Recirculated water can be made up to flow from bottom by above-mentioned setting, to ensure that cooling water fills
Full whole water cooling tube, it is ensured that its cooling effect.
Exemplarily, described fire grate segment is provided with bolt sleeve 4, and available bolt is connected with incinerator framework, it is easy to change.
Described bolt sleeve 4 also acts as the effect welding reinforcement between header board 1 and back plate 2.
When incinerator works, the heat that fuel combustion produces is radiated to side wall fire grate segment surface, and temperature passes through metal furnaces
Screening surface is transferred to cool down water;Cooling water is driven by water-cooling system, water inlet 5 enter internal water cavity, through outlet 6 row
Go out, enter water-cooling circulating system and heat is shed, continue to be recycled into fire grate segment after reducing water temperature.
